TODO how to compare ERA-model: Iuliia's answer: "load the data, calculate ensemble mean, calculate anomalies with respect to the long-term mean, calculate RMSE or CORR for different lead times et voila. If you have problems just let me know, I will help. The skill is usually calculated for anomalies and for lead times, so for prediction year 1, and multi-year averages such as years 2-5. Depending on the research problem, we calculate skill for each grid-point or for the anomalies averaged over a certain region.
